Abstract

Official abstract text for this publication.

A powered ratcheting wrench includes a main housing defining a grip portion, a motor having a motor drive shaft, a drive assembly coupled to the motor drive shaft and driven by the motor, and an output assembly coupled to the drive assembly. The output assembly includes an output member that receives torque from the drive assembly, causing the output member to rotate about an axis. The powered ratcheting wrench further includes a head housing coupled to the main housing and supporting at least a portion of the drive assembly. The head housing is composed of an aluminum alloy resulting in a center of gravity for the power tool to be proximate the grip portion.

First claim

Opening claim text (preview).

What is claimed is: 1. A powered ratcheting wrench comprising: a main housing defining a grip portion; a motor having a motor drive shaft; a drive assembly coupled to the motor drive shaft and driven by the motor about a first axis; an output assembly coupled to the drive assembly, wherein the output assembly includes a ratchet mechanism and an output member, both of which receive torque from the drive assembly, causing the output member to rotate about a second axis; a head housing coupled to the main housing and surrounding at least a portion of the drive assembly and at least a portion of the motor, wherein the head housing defines a first end of the wrench and the main housing defines an opposite, second end of the wrench; and a battery pack selectively coupled to the main housing at the second end for providing power to the motor when activated, wherein the head housing is composed of an A380 aluminum alloy resulting in a center of gravity of the wrench to be proximate the grip portion, wherein the center of gravity is between 170 millimeters and 185 millimeters away from the first end when the battery pack is coupled to the main housing. 2. The powered ratcheting wrench of claim 1 , wherein the head housing is coupled to the main housing with a series of fasteners extending through the main housing and the head housing. 3. The powered ratcheting wrench of claim 2 , wherein the series of fasteners each extend toward the first axis in a direction perpendicular to the first axis. 4. The powered ratcheting wrench of claim 1 , wherein the center of gravity is 175 millimeters away from the first end when the battery pack is coupled to the main housing. 5. The powered ratcheting wrench of claim 1 , wherein the center of gravity is between 102 millimeters and 112 millimeters away from the first end when the battery pack is removed from the main housing. 6. The powered ratcheting wrench of claim 1 , wherein the center of gravity is 107 millimeters away from the first end when the battery pack is removed from the main housing. 7. The powered ratcheting wrench of claim 1 , wherein the second axis is perpendicular to the first axis. 8. The powered ratcheting wrench of claim 1 , wherein the ratchet mechanism includes a yoke, and wherein the drive assembly includes a crankshaft for providing an oscillating input to the yoke for intermittently rotating the output member in a first rotational direction about the second axis. 9. The powered ratcheting wrench of claim 8 , wherein the ratchet mechanism is adjustable for intermittently rotating the output member in a second rotational direction about the second axis in response to the oscillating input provided to the yoke. 10. The powered ratcheting wrench of claim 8 , wherein the output member is rotationally locked by the yoke when the motor is deactivated and when the power tool is manually rotated about the second axis. 11. The powered ratcheting wrench of claim 1 , wherein the head housing encases a planetary geartrain, a crankshaft, and a majority of the motor. 12. The powered ratcheting wrench of claim 1 , further comprising a paddle to selectively activate the motor, wherein the paddle is disposed rearwardly of the center of gravity relative to the first axis when the battery pack is coupled to the main housing. 13. A powered ratcheting wrench comprising: a main housing defining a grip portion; a motor having a motor drive shaft rotatable about a first axis; a drive assembly coupled to the motor drive shaft and driven by the motor, and an output assembly coupled to the drive assembly, wherein the output assembly includes a ratcheting mechanism and an output member, both of which receive torque from the drive assembly, causing the output member to rotate about a second axis that is perpendicular to the first axis; a head housing coupled to the main housing and surrounding at least a portion of the drive assembly and at least a portion of the motor, wherein the head housing defines a first end of the wrench and the main housing defines an opposite, second end of the wrench; and a battery pack selectively coupled to the main housing at the second end for providing power to the motor when activated, wherein the head housing is composed of an A380 aluminum alloy resulting in a center of gravity of the wrench that is enveloped by the hand of a user when being grasped by a user, wherein the center of gravity is between 170 millimeters and 185 millimeters away from the first end when the battery pack is coupled to the main housing. 14. The powered ratcheting wrench of claim 13 , wherein the head housing is coupled to the main housing with a fastener extending through the main housing and the head housing. 15. The powered ratcheting wrench of claim 14 , wherein the fastener extends toward the first axis in a direction perpendicular to the first axis. 16. The powered ratcheting wrench of claim 13 , wherein the center of gravity is 175 millimeters away from the first end when the battery pack is coupled to the main housing. 17. The powered ratcheting wrench of claim 13 , wherein the center of gravity is between 102 millimeters and 112 millimeters away from the first end when the battery pack is removed from the main housing. 18. The powered ratcheting wrench of claim 13 , wherein the center of gravity is 107 millimeters away from the first end when the battery pack is removed from the main housing. 19. The powered ratcheting wrench of claim 13 , wherein the ratchet mechanism includes a yoke, wherein the drive assembly includes a crankshaft for providing an oscillating input to the yoke for intermittently rotating the output member in a first rotational direction about the second axis, wherein the ratchet mechanism is adjustable for intermittently rotating the output member in a second rotational direction about the second axis in response to the oscillating input provided to the yoke, and wherein the output member is rotationally locked by the yoke when the motor is deactivated and when the power tool is manually rotated about the second axis. 20. The powered ratcheting wrench of claim 13 , wherein the head housing encases a planetary geartrain, a crankshaft, and a majority of the motor. 21. The powered ratcheting wrench of claim 13 , further comprising a paddle to selectively activate the motor, wherein the paddle is disposed rearwardly of the center of gravity relative to the first axis when the battery pack is coupled to the main housing. 22.
